jackhutton 🇺🇸<p>“When Chancellor Heinrich Brüning’s government declared a long bank holiday on July 13, 1931, after a run on the banks following the collapse of the Darmstädter and Nationalbank, the economic crisis began to hit home. There was a “9% salary reduction” for civil servants [..] and higher value-added taxes for consumers"</p><p>Excerpt From<br>Hitler's First Hundred Days<br>Peter Fritzsche</p><p><a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/fascism"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>fascism</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/maga"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>maga</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/learnfromthepast"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>learnfromthepast</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/hitlersFirstHundredDays"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>hitlersFirstHundredDays</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/peterFritzsche"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>peterFritzsche</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/wwii"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>wwii</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/history"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>history</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/1930s"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>1930s</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/books"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>books</span></a> <a href="https://mstdn.social/tags/bookstodon"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>bookstodon</span></a></p>
